Review #856; Scotch #204: Caperdonich 25yr (1994) SMWS 38.28 “Warms the cockles of your heart”

This bottling comes to us by way of the Scotch Malt Whiskey Society from Caperdonich, the closed speyside distillery. This Single malt was aged for 25 years in a 2nd fill ex-bourbon barrel before being bottled at cask strength with no additives and was non-chill filtered. Review #853; Scotch #202: Single Cask Nation Aultmore 8yr

This bottling comes to us by way of Single Cask Nation, an American Independent bottler. This cask spent 8 years ageing in a first fill bourbon barrel before it was selected by SCN and bottled at cask strength with no additives or chill filtering. Review #852; Rum #241: Chairman’s Reserve Master Select 8yr (2011) 50/50 JD1/Coffey

This Chariman’s Reserve Master Selection is a barrel pick done by K&L Wines out in California. This St. Lucia Distillers rum was aged for 8 years in ex-bourbon before being bottled for K&L with no chill filtering or additives. This is a blend of 50% John Dore 1 pot still distillate and 50% Coffey Column

Review #849; Scotch #201: Ballechin 11yr (2009) “r/scotch select”

This bottling is an 11-year-old Ballechin from the Edradour distillery. Distilled in 2009 then aged for 11 years in a first fill sherry cask, it was bottled at cask strength with no additives or filtering by The Ultimate Whisky Company.
